Overview

Villa Romita Sant'Agata sui due Golfi hotel includes 22 rooms and is about 25 minutes' walk from Marine Reserve Punta Campanella Nature Preserve. Guests can swim in an outdoor swimming pool, while this hotel provides views of the gulf.

Location

The centre of Sant'Agata sui due Golfi is a 10 minutes' walk of the accommodation. The stylish hotel in Sant'Agata sui due Golfi is within easy reach of Il Deserto. This property is surrounded by a garden and a grove. About 25 minutes' walk from Museo Correale is a perk for guests staying at the 3-star Villa Romita hotel.

Rooms

The rooms include a mini-fridge-bar, along with a flat-screen TV with satellite channels for your convenience. Also, this accommodation features terracotta flooring. Bathroom amenities include a bathtub and a separate toilet, along with comforts such as a hairdryer and towels.

Eat & Drink

Breakfast is served in the restaurant each morning. The Villa Romita offers a menu of Italian cuisine, which you can taste in the à la carte Sala dei Sogni restaurant. The spacious bar is also available. There is a bar serving Italian food only a 13-minute walk away.

Leisure & Business

Guests can make different arrangements at this grand hotel, including snorkelling, diving, and canoeing or rent bicycles to explore Sant'Agata sui due Golfi.

    At Hermitage: Very welcoming and helpful staff. Pool at has proper deep end. Breakfast not exciting but plentiful. The Romita annexe is pleasant, clean, simple. A few hundred yards uphill walk away. Fridge in room requires purchase for electric lead. Wifi in room and good value for 3 days. Hotel used by Thompsons. Chill out by the pool; look out over Sorrento way down below and the bay; book shuttle bus in advance if you don't have car.

    Previous reviews mentioning distance from Sorrento itself and the dangers of extremely narrow streets if following a sat nav route are correct. Keep to main road and keep going up and up. We used this to visit Pompei etc and found that the traffic queues in late August on the single road in and out of the peninsula made the return journeys at night lengthy.

    The villa only a short walk from the hotel hermitage was excellant we prefered to be away from the main hotel. The breakfast taken at the hotel was excellant as much as you want no limits. The swimming pool was super clean, a baby pool was attached but very safe. Free bathing towels are supplied. The local town of sant'agata is lovely with a few bars and resturants,mini's is recommened great food the town is only a few minutes away. The shuttle service provided (free) is a god send as you are about 15/20 mins away from Sorrento book you place a day in advance service runs from 8.30am until 11.15pm-a taxi will cost about 40 euros. A bus stop is right outsde the hotel but doesn't run late. Free use of computor in reception

    To gain access to the frdge we had to ask reception to turn it on, and buy something for it. Tv was similar, no fee but had to ask reception to set it up. No wi-fi available for free, however computer with internet access was available in reception. No tea or coffee facilities in rooms. These comments are minor issues, and does not detract from a great villa.
